Home People Dewshane Williams Dewshane Williams shows Dewshane Williams shows Dewshane Williams TV Shows (7) The Expanse (2015) As Corporal Sa'id, Supergirl (2015) As Till'all, Defiance (2013) As Tommy LaSalle, Defiance (2013) As Himself, Lost Girl (2010) As Jason Gaines, Baxter (2010) As Jackal Corman, Flashpoint (2008)